“Homosexuality is a choice”: It’s a ridiculous statement that’s been around as long as bigotry and hatred.

Recently, US Republican presidential candidate Ben Carson made the mistake of sprouting this incredibly misinformed view in an interview with CNN.

Carson blatantly stated that being gay is a choice: “A lot of people who go into prison, go into prison straight, and when they come out they’re gay,” he told CNN.

Savage copped some flack for his brilliant comeback – a CNN host asked him why he lowered himself to Carson’s level.

“Sometimes you have to fight fire with fire,” Savage responded.

“Ben Carson [has] compared gay people to child rapists, people who have sex with animals, necrophilia… [He] says the vilest and most disgusting things about gay people.

“Sometimes to get the attention of someone like that – to really make it clear to them how disgusting they are being – you have to meet them on the field where they are doing battle and take them on.”
